Chimchar, because the rest of the Fire-types in Sinnoh suck, especially since we don't know if we're getting the vanilla Sinnoh Dex or the Platinum Dex. Plus, it's the most versatile of the three and has the best advantages in Sinnoh. And I tend to favor Fire starters anyway. As much as I love Torterra, I can't pick him because he just plain suffers in his home region. Both he and Empoleon just aren't built too well for Sinnoh, so Infernape will be my starter of choice.
